Output 44e3a24b57d69122b39c13e5cb2272c0eae7f69c74eaa9b19883707014693bb4:25

value
739628882
script pubkey
OP_0 OP_PUSHBYTES_20 5c3df5559ddf879a6c93c488284efa3aed046232
address
bc1qts7l24vam7re5myncjyzsnh68tksgc3jxpztda
transaction
44e3a24b57d69122b39c13e5cb2272c0eae7f69c74eaa9b19883707014693bb4
spent
true